Britannia Bourbon sparks worldwide debate with its chocolate layering

Watch the film conceptualised by The Womb here

Britannia Bourbon has rolled out a campaign to highlight its triple-layered chocolate biscuit. 

 

Conceptualised by The Womb, the film portrays the intrigue surrounding Britannia Bourbon's innovative triple-layered chocolate delicacy. As the narrative unfolds, it playfully engages international delegates in a debate regarding whether the biscuit is genuinely composed of chocolate stacked upon chocolate upon chocolate, or perhaps chocolate nestled beneath chocolate beneath chocolate.

Suyash Khabya, creative head, The Womb, said, "The account manager and planning said Britannia Bourbon ki brief hai 'chocolate pe chocolate pe chocolate' (the brief for Britannia Bourbon is chocolate on chocolate on chocolate). On expected lines, creative said 'don't agree'! It's chocolate below chocolate below chocolate'. And boom! That was the idea. A debate. But rather than keeping the debate to a gully in India, we took it global. Gave it a scale. We got the world to argue, and aggressively. A simple idea but unignorable. Or is it the other way around? Now, that's another debate."
